Located in Downtown Fort Lauderdale within a short walk of The Galleria at Fort Lauderdale, The Link Hotel is within 2 miles (3 km) of other popular sights such as Fort Lauderdale Beach. This 144-room, 3-star hotel has an outdoor pool along with a gym and a 24-hour business center.
Satisfy your hunger from the comfort of your room with room service.
Flat-screen TVs come with cable channels. Beds sport down comforters and bathrooms offer hair dryers. Other amenities include refrigerators, coffee makers, and free local calls.
The Link Hotel features an outdoor pool, a gym, and conference space. If you drive, self parking is USD 11.30 per night, and there's also an airport shuttle. The 24-hour front desk has multilingual staff ready to help with luggage storage, and answer any questions about the area. Additional amenities include a 24-hour business center, coffee/tea in a common area, and a computer station.
